SW 844 Essential Theories in Organizations and Communities Social Work Practice

Semester:
Fall of every year
Credits:
Total Credits: Credits: 2   Lecture/Recitation/Discussion Hours:2
Prerequisite:
SW 810
Restrictions:
Open to graduate students in the School of Social Work or approval of school.
Description:
Selected theoretical approaches to organizational and community phenomena. Emphasis on macro-organization and community theories using organization and community as the level of analysis. Decision-making by a collective of organizational and community actors. Organization and community functions.
Effective Dates:
FS09 - FS09
